【问题标题】:Creating dynamic UI in Kentico CMS在 Kentico CMS 中创建动态 UI
【发布时间】:2018-08-02 07:13:40
【问题描述】:

我在 Kentico CMS 中创建了一个静态 UI,现在我想让它动态化。我还没有后端代码。是否有任何可能的方法可以在不使用后端客户端代码的情况下创建动态 UI?请给我一个解决方案。

提前致谢。

【问题讨论】:

  • dynamic 是什么意思?

标签: c# asp.net user-interface dynamic kentico


【解决方案1】:

Kentico 提供了一堆 UI 模板,您可以轻松地构建自定义类的 crud(创建读取更新删除)。

您通常必须生成它们的类代码文件,但使用对象列表、编辑/新对象和垂直选项卡模板,如果您想用触摸代码做什么,您可以构建大多数。

您可以随时查看 Kentico 的现有模块,了解他们的 UI 页面是如何配置的,尽管有一些用户自定义界面。 https://docs.kentico.com/k11/custom-development/creating-custom-modules#Creatingcustommodules-Buildingthemoduleinterface

【讨论】:

    【解决方案2】:

    为了让某些属性显示您的自定义类值,您需要为这些类生成代码并将其放置在文件系统中。这是 Kentico 知道这些类正确存在的唯一方法。它将数据库与在代码中注册的类进行比较,然后允许它们显示。我指的是当您为对象配置列表或编辑模板时的类列表。

    我们的典型过程是先创建模块中的所有类,然后在创建所有类后生成代码,以便进行一次重新编译而不是多次重新编译。

    【讨论】:

      猜你喜欢
      • 2011-12-07
      • 1970-01-01
      • 2018-06-28
      • 1970-01-01
      • 1970-01-01
      • 2011-04-24
      • 1970-01-01
      • 2012-06-20
      • 1970-01-01
      相关资源
      最近更新 更多